Position Overview:

As an HR Winter Student, you will support several HR initiatives and be responsible for providing administrative support. This role provides first level support to HR Business Partners for their inquiries and services. In addition, this role will support various Loblaw Corporate client groups by coordinating and following through on various Human Resources activities and projects including Company-wide Human Resources programs/initiatives.

What You'll Do:

  • Data validation in Workday for compliance and people objectives
  • Gather data and perform detailed analysis of Individual Development Plans, Exit Interviews, Training, and other adhoc reporting.
  • Resolve necessary payroll inquiries, updating colleague information in Workday, submitting IT tickets as required
  • Headcount review, tracking, and updating org charts
  • Revamping onboarding and training guides, prepare announcements for new hires
  • Colleague Engagement Survey: adhoc reporting, score carding, crafting presentation decks, participation update emails, analysis and recommendations, and all other admin support
  • Support the Talent Review by taking detailed notes, updating talent grids, cleaning up files for final review with leadership team
  • Admin support for training sessions – Open Mic, Mental Health, Workshops. Support note taking, analysis, and follow up in Let's Chat sessions.
  • Assist Sr. Director and HRBP's with all other research, analysis and implementation of programs, root cause analysis and identifying solutions, reports, projects, and crafting presentation decks as required
  • Assist with Blue Culture activities, research and plan events and ideas for team building events and recognition ideas
  • All other admin support as required such as adhoc reporting, photocopying, filing, labeling, booking meeting rooms, etc.
  • Continuing your education by completing some of Loblaw's great e-learning courses, attending workshops, training and seminars
